Subject: LingoPull cut-over done

Welcome aboard. The cut-over of the LingoPull string-extraction script to the new pipeline finished last night. Old cron jobs are disabled; extraction now triggers on merge. Two locales had stale catalogs and were re-run manually. Everything you need to run it locally is in the values below.

deployment values, yahag-tawef:
ZORWYN_HOST=zorwyn.tolvaqlabs.internal
ZORWYN_PORT=9300

Ticket: Staging env misconfigured for Siftgate bloom filter

The bloom layer in front of the Pellet KV store is rejecting all lookups in staging because the env file was copied from the dev template without credentials. False-positive tuning values are fine; only the auth line is missing. To unblock the weekly demo, the Pellet admission secret must be set on the following line.

env line for yaguf-fajop: LEDGER_TOKEN13=fb08984397349

Subject: Broker upgrade cut-over summary

Hi Dagny,

The Ferrowave broker cluster at Tilbeck Logistics was upgraded from 3.8 to 5.1 last night. Cut-over took 42 minutes, under the one-hour window. Producers were paused, queues drained, and consumers reattached without message loss — Olle verified offsets afterward. Two minor issues: one consumer group needed a manual rebalance, and the metrics exporter required a restart. No rollback triggers were hit. The cluster now runs with the following configuration values.

config for bahaf-yagef:
[prair]
team = zordor
access_code = ac_f81712
host = prair.olvarqcloud.local
port = 3306
owner = quenix.fraiel
peer = istys.torvaworks.internal

### Runbook: Stale-cache incident (Ledgerline outage, March)

If invoice totals look frozen, suspect the Quillcache layer first. During the March incident, the invalidation worker silently dropped events after a schema change. Verify the worker heartbeat, then flush the affected namespace. Flushing requires an authenticated call to the Quillcache admin service, using the key below.

gateway credential: zpat4_qSKI